The Reality of the Charter System

For those unfamiliar with how NASCAR’s charter system works, it is essentially a way to provide long-term security for teams in the Cup Series. Charters are issued to teams, ensuring they have a spot in every race for a fixed number of years. Teams with charters are no longer required to qualify for each race, allowing them to focus on the race itself rather than stressing over making the field. But earning a charter is no simple task—it requires significant investment, a stable organization, and a deep understanding of the sport’s complex business aspects.

While the charter system has brought stability to some teams, it has also created a sense of exclusivity within the sport. Only 36 charters are available, and those who secure one are positioned to have a more secure future in the Cup Series.
